Description

Since different projects have different project managers and development managers. Providing admin rights to such users create confusion and a threat to redmine integrity.

In my organisation, we are using Redmine for different projects, so different users can have same role. Due to this an user in one project get same rights as that of other user in another project. Somehow I can manage this situation by making project as private but there is a need to see issues of other projects in order to get information from those trackers.

Don't we need a logic for assigning roles permissions based on project instead of globally. Here Administrator should be able to set Roles permission in project itself and of course local admin for each project.
